I did quite a bit of messing around with my amp and sansamp bddi settings and decided to record something to get the opinions of the MoCWB and CWB.

Here is what I did: At the start of the song until after the first chorus, it is just my amp. I have the mids slightly boosted (150, 350, and 800 Hz) and all other EQ settings are flat. After the first chorus until a little bit into the solo, my SansAmp BDDI is active (it's running through the instrument input on the amp). All settings on the BDDI are 'flat' and the line setting is set to match the amp's gain knob. In my opinion, the SansAmp rounds out the bottom a bit when it is active. Anyways, have a listen (with headphones or good desktop speakers) and tell me which you prefer.
